Output 7c446b43f7f91b4513a9fb93d5c450f9af0aeff2a8e37d2961ce6edab1bd620d:1

value
23216436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81c0f9cb883f8b7d855300d660151f682cb23e9 OP_EQUAL
address
3MPhVh1GVgVHV1wCvff23MNhBX3y24JSxv
transaction
7c446b43f7f91b4513a9fb93d5c450f9af0aeff2a8e37d2961ce6edab1bd620d
confirmations
373876
spent
true